Atrial fibrillation can arise from a range of underlying mechanisms, including electrical triggers, structural remodeling, metabolic influences, and inflammatory substrates, each of which requires a tailored therapeutic strategy. Understanding the specific atrial substrate responsible for the arrhythmia is therefore essential to guide appropriate management. In this context, echocardiography serves not only as a diagnostic tool but also as a key decision-making instrument, enabling clinicians to noninvasively evaluate the structural, mechanical, and electrical properties of the left atrium. Parameters such as left atrial strain, conduction time (PA-tissue Doppler imaging), and left atrial volume index provide valuable insights into the extent of atrial remodeling and fibrosis, which directly influence therapeutic choices and expected outcomes. While the diagnostic role of echocardiography in atrial fibrillation is well recognized, its integration into therapeutic decision-making, particularly in guiding rhythm control strategies, remains underutilized. This case series aims to address that gap by illustrating how echocardiographic findings can inform the selection, timing, and modality of interventional versus conservative treatment. We present three patients with distinct clinical backgrounds: one with structurally normal atria, one with atrial remodeling due to epicardial adipose tissue infiltration, and one elderly patient with moderate substrate alteration, where comorbidities and minimal symptom burden led to a conservative management decision. Each case highlights how advanced echocardiographic assessment can support individualized treatment planning, from catheter ablation to optimal medical therapy, in alignment with precision medicine principles.
